The Colorado Rockies put Friday's loss to the Chicago Cubs behind them on Saturday and pulled out a late-inning charge for a 4-3 win. A series victory on Sunday is possible, and it most certainly would be a good way to head back to Coors Field on Monday.
Jhoulys Chacin (1-3, 6.16 ERA) is making just his second start since coming off a three-month stint on the disabled list. He was impressive in his return on Tuesday against the New York Mets, picking up his first win of the year after throwing six innings of one-run ball. He walked zero batters, struck out two and allowed four hits.
Chris Volstad (0-9, 6.88 ERA) will look to join the ranks of the winners by the end of the game, but that will require some solid pitching on his part. In his 13 starts this season, Volstad has seen his Cubs go just 1-12. While not spectacular, he has pitched decently over his last few starts, most recently allowing four runs over six innings to the Cincinnati Reds. He struck out four in the 5-4 loss.
